Mourners gathered in Gaza City on Thursday (August 20) to attend the funerals of Palestinians whose bodies were recently recovered from beneath the rubble.
Fifty bodies were recently pulled from the ruins of houses belonging to the Sawafiri, Batniji and Karam families, according to Gaza's civil defence.
Palestinian Lynn Karam was among those at the funeral. She said that for nearly three years, she had nowhere to mourn her mother, sister and brother whose bodies remained buried beneath the rubble of their Gaza home after an Israeli strike early in the war.
“I knew that a big wound would be opened, but it's not a problem, the important thing is that we honour them, we honour them at their resting place," Karam said.
Gaza's civil defence spokesperson Mahmoud Basal said teams had retrieved a total of about 180 bodies over 50 days from 17 homes.
Basal said more than 8,000 people remained under the rubble across the enclave, requiring great effort and resources to retrieve them.
